Artificial Intelligence - Threat or Opportunity?


Artificial Intelligence


Artificial intelligence (AI) is an area of computer science that emphasizes the creation of intelligent machines that work and react like humans.
Artificial Intelligence (AI) is transforming the nature of almost everything which is connected to human life e.g. employment, economy, communication, warfare, privacy, security, ethics, healthcare etc. However, we are  yet to see its  evolution in long-term, whether  it’s leading humanity towards making this planet a better place to live or a place which is full of disaster. Every  technology  has  its  advantages  and  disadvantages  but  advantages  always  outweigh disadvantages  for  the  technology  to  survive  in  the  market.  Nonetheless,  for  Artificial Intelligence we  are not yet sure whether in the long-term positive effects will always keep outweighing the negative effects and if that is not the case then we are in serious trouble. If we  look around  us,  on the  one hand,  we  seem to  embrace  the change  being brought  by technology, be it smart home, smart healthcare, Industry 4.0 or autonomous cars. On the other hand,  we  often  found  ourselves  protesting  against  the  government  in  the  context  of unemployment,  taxes,  privacy  etc.  As  AI  development  is  speeding  up,  more  robots  or autonomous  systems  are  being  born  and  replacing  the  human  labor.  This  is  the  current situation; however, in long-term, results seem to get more interesting.
